Englefield · Suburb / Locality
What people believe — religious affiliation and those with no religion.
A significant shift toward secularism has occurred in Englefield, where over half the population now reports having no religion. This reflects a trend far stronger than the state or national average, with 56.5% of residents identifying as non-religious.
The mix of religions, and people with no religion.
More than half of residents (56.5%) claim no religion, a figure far above the 39.3% seen in Victoria. Christianity is the next most common affiliation at 26.1%, while there are no residents identifying as Muslim, Hindu, or Buddhist.
